What are the ultimate rewards for a devotee who has true devotion to the Guru, as described in Chapter 46?

πŸ“– Chapter 46

Chapter 46 of the Sai Satcharitra glorifies the state of a true devotee, proclaiming that one who has such devotion to the Guru will lack nothing and will obtain whatever they desire without effort. The text elevates this state by stating that even the coveted realization of Brahman serves such a devotee like a maid-servant. Furthermore, liberation is not something they need to ask for, and holy pilgrimages are said to come to them. This chapter clearly states that sincere devotion brings Peace, Detachment, and Fame, placing the devotee in a state of complete fulfillment.
